Health minister, Raqqa governor discuss support for healthcare sector

Published: 2026/03/06 11:01 AM
Updated: 2026/03/06 11:01 AM
Health minister, Raqqa governor discuss support for healthcare sector
Minister Musab al-Ali met with Raqqa Governor Abdulrahman Salama

Damascus, March 6 (SANA) Syrian Health Minister Musab al-Ali met with Raqqa Governor Abdulrahman Salama to discuss the state of healthcare services in the governorate and measures to improve medical care and strengthen the preparedness of health facilities.

According to a statement on the ministry’s Telegram channel, the meeting reviewed challenges facing Raqqa’s healthcare sector, including the needs of hospitals and health centers.

Al-Ali said hospitals and laboratories in Raqqa will be supplied with modern medical equipment in the coming period to enhance their ability to meet citizens’ needs. Both sides emphasized the importance of coordination between the ministry and Raqqa Governorate to improve healthcare services across the region.

Raqqa’s healthcare sector suffered significant damage in recent years, leaving several hospitals and health centers out of service. Authorities are working to rehabilitate facilities and gradually restore them to full operation.
